Output 20cab4b3bb5198decf7375511bf6ed6e2302b9e20444b1d56ce31296cb4051a8:21

value
24209780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f895a49d9c385f0a1d5eac9099665a9fb404b419 OP_EQUALVERIFY OP_CHECKSIG
address
1PfPqxL4frRvB9pPWyxjEL2nAyWA6NMUhF
transaction
20cab4b3bb5198decf7375511bf6ed6e2302b9e20444b1d56ce31296cb4051a8
spent
true